Saturday, October 14: Trek to Vaishno Devi Shrine

Embark on a trek to the Vaishno Devi Shrine, one of the most revered pilgrimage sites in India. Start early in the morning to avoid crowds and enjoy the cool weather. The 13-kilometer uphill trek will take around 6-8 hours, but you can also hire a pony or palanquin if needed. Along the way, take in the bre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and pristine nature. Upon reaching the shrine, offer your prayers to the Goddess and seek her blessings. Afterward, make your way back to Katra and rest for the night.

  • Trek to Vaishno Devi Shrine: Free, 6-8 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Katra, make sure to visit the Ranbireshwar Temple, a beautiful Shiva temple known for its tranquil surroundings. Another hidden gem is the Shivkhori Cave, located 70 kilometers from Katra, which houses a naturally formed Shivalinga. Locals also recommend trying the delicious local cuisine at the numerous food stalls and restaurants in Katra, where you can savor authentic flavors and specialties of the region. Don't forget to try the famous Rajma Chawal, a popular local dish.
